Re-standardisation of the (Central South Consortium - CSC) Standardised Welsh Reading Test

We are urgently looking for secondary schools to take part in the Re-standardisation of the (Central South Consortium - CSC) Standardised Welsh Reading Test, with a focus on Years 10 and 11.
12/06/2026 00:00:00

Please note, this activity is separate from, and not part of, the Welsh Government’s mandatory national personalised assessments.

Why take part

  • Help create more accurate reading ages for learners in Wales.

  • Support fair, national assessment.

  • Contribute to improved literacy resources for the secondary sector.

What is required

  • 2 short tests (15 to 20 minutes each, within one month of each other).

  • Administered one-to-one.

  • To be completed between May and the end of the academic year.

Benefit to your school

  • £5 book voucher for each learner who completes both tests.

  • More robust reading data to support teaching.

  • Even a small number of learners are a very valuable contribution.

Next steps

  • Express your interest by emailing profion@cardiff.ac.uk.

  • Confirm the number of learners.

  • Receive access details.

  • Schedule the sessions.
